How to Create WhatsApp Template Messages in Chatzy AI
Hey there! Welcome to this guide, where you will learn how to create WhatsApp template messages in Chatzy AI. Before moving forward, make sure you have connected your WhatsApp number to Chatzy AI and it is visible under Channels → WhatsApp. If not, please check the previous tutorial video before proceeding.Step 1: Navigate to Message Templates
- Go to the Message Templates section of Chatzy AI.
- Select the WhatsApp channel to view your existing templates and their approval status.
- If you haven’t created any templates yet, this page will be empty.
- Click on the
+ Create Templatebutton to start creating a new template.
Step 2: Select the Right Category
WhatsApp requires you to choose a category for each template. This defines its purpose:| Category | Purpose |
|---|---|
| Authentication | One-time passwords (OTPs), login verification. |
| Utility | Transactional updates: order confirmations, account updates, reminders. |
| Marketing | Promotional content, sales announcements, brand awareness. |
💡 Tip: Choosing the correct category is essential. Selecting the wrong one may lead to rejection by Meta.
Marketing templates usually cost more to send. For pricing details, visit the Pricing page on Chatzy AI.

Step 3: Add Basic Information
- Template Name → Pick a unique and easy-to-identify name.
- Language → Choose the language of your message.
- Decide if the template will contain text only or media.
- Select the media type in the Header dropdown and upload your file.
- The uploaded media is only for preview. You will need to upload it again while sending campaigns.
Step 4: Write the Message
- Body → This is the main message content. Supports emojis, bold, and italic text.
- Keep it short and engaging for better delivery rates.
- Footer (optional) → Use it for greetings or less prominent info.
Step 5: Add Interactivity with Buttons
Buttons make your template interactive:| Button Type | Action |
|---|---|
| Quick Reply | Lets users reply with predefined options directly in WhatsApp. |
| Call to Action (CTA) | Takes users to a webpage or initiates a phone call. |

Step 6: Use Variables for Personalization
Variables let you insert dynamic, user-specific details like names, order numbers, or dates.- Add variables in the Header (Text type) or Body using double curly brackets.
- Example:
{{1}},{{2}}for multiple placeholders. - Add sample values for each variable to help Meta understand and approve your template faster.
⚠️ These sample values are for demonstration only. You must provide real values when sending campaigns.
Step 7: Review & Submit
Once everything looks good in the preview:- Click Create to submit your template.
- Meta usually approves templates within a few seconds, but it may take up to 24 hours.
- Refresh the page to check the template’s status.

✅ Final Tips
- Follow WhatsApp’s template guidelines strictly.
- Submitting promotional language under Utility or Authentication categories may cause rejection.
